Best time to visit Kujūku Islands

The best time to visit is during the late afternoon to catch the golden hour sunset from Kanzan Peak, or in spring when the coastal azaleas are in full bloom. Autumn offers crisp, clear skies perfect for cruising, while summer provides warm weather ideal for kayaking, though you should expect larger crowds during Japanese national holidays.

How long to spend

Allocate at least half a day to fully enjoy a Pearl Sea cruise, explore the resort's marine facilities, and have a relaxed seafood lunch. If you are short on time, prioritize the 50-minute sightseeing cruise and a quick trip to Kanzan Peak for the best panoramic views of the archipelago.

Kujūku Islands tickets & prices

Entry to the resort grounds and viewpoints is generally free, but the Pearl Sea cruises, kayak rentals, and aquarium exhibits require separate tickets. Combo passes are available for travellers looking to bundle the cruise with marine activities, and discounted rates are offered for children, seniors, and groups.

Top things to do

  • Take a scenic Kujukushima Pearl Sea Resort cruise to navigate the labyrinth of lush, uninhabited islands and spot local wildlife.
  • Hike or drive up to Kanzan Peak to witness a spectacular sunset over the archipelago, where the islands look like pieces of a natural ocean puzzle.
  • Indulge in freshly grilled seasonal oysters at the local coastal markets and seafood stalls near Sasebo Port.
  • Explore the Kujukushima Pearl Sea Resort to enjoy interactive marine exhibits, kayak rentals, and family-friendly aquariums.

Hidden gems

  • Seek out the lesser-known viewing spots at Tenkaiho Observatory for a panoramic, crowd-free perspective of the Minami Kujuku Islands.
  • Visit during the spring azalea bloom season when the hillsides of the islands and surrounding coastal parks burst into vibrant shades of pink and red.
  • Look for the unique heart-shaped island formations visible only from specific angles during the Pearl Sea cruise or via drone photography where permitted.

Accessibility

The Kujukushima Pearl Sea Resort is highly accessible, featuring ramp access, wheelchair-friendly restrooms, and elevators in the main buildings. While the main cruise vessels accommodate wheelchairs on the lower decks, some natural hiking trails and viewpoints like Kanzan Peak may have steep or uneven sections that are difficult to navigate.
